Yuming Wang is a leading researcher in tribology and mechanical sealing, with a particular focus on the lubrication and performance of rotary lip seals under complex industrial conditions. His major contribution lies in advancing the understanding of mixed lubrication regimes through deterministic models of surface microdeformation, challenging the limitations of traditional reverse pumping theory. Wang’s 2021 paper, “A Mixed Lubrication Model for Lip Seals Based on Deterministic Surface Microdeformation,” has garnered 22 citations, reflecting its impact on engineers designing seals for robotics and high-performance machinery. This work is especially notable for addressing the behavior of lip seals with varying radial forces and incomplete motion, such as those found in robot joint seals—a critical area for modern automation. By bridging the gap between theoretical models and real-world application, Wang has provided a framework that improves seal reliability and efficiency.
